Prize. hi j.Molbourn 9 ' :■ Exhibition,) i .'' ; ' : '--,-i^:.'.:.'. .■>!■ AT REDUCED: PRICES. ; rCS -v REID& GRAY'S NEW ZEALAND TWINE BINDER: % «qh&lly as light of draught and much more durable than the best imported, and **& the Society's Gold Medal at the Oamaru Trial last season, cutting four acres of Story «rop in 2 hours 11 minutes. In the report on Implements in the recent ExhiHWiii Mr Reeves, the Commissioner of Agriculture, writes as follows:—" In the HtWacturo of that essentially American machine—the Reaper and Binder—a Cologkl jJrm iB turning out of their yards a machine equally as good as tho American M&o in all parts, and can also sell it at a price which will compare favorably with nit uked for the imported article." .
